An exciting opportunity has arisen at Capel Manor College and we are now seeking to appoint a Lecturer in Horticulture to provide high‑quality teaching and learning to our Horticulture students. The ideal candidate will be delivering and assessing to the appropriate examination body standards across Levels 1 to 3 on a range of subjects related to Horticulture, including but not limited to Amenity Horticulture, Plant Science, Propagation, Soil Science, Machinery, Landscaping and Ecology, and Garden History.

The post holder will provide high‑quality teaching across the College’s Horticulture courses, primarily the RHS Level 2 Certificate in Practical Horticulture and RHS Level 2 Certificate in the Principles of Plant Growth and Development, to ensure the effective learning of students being taught. This will involve preparing and delivering stimulating lessons, setting goals that stretch and challenge all students, monitoring and assessing student progress, giving feedback and consistently demonstrating the positive attitudes, values and behaviours which are expected of students.

They will be supported by a team of practical instructors and technicians with regards to the provision of practical learner activities and ensure that all requirements and regulations relating to health and safety are adhered to at all times. Applicants should possess a Degree, HND or other relevant qualification in a related discipline. We welcome applications from experienced Lecturers and from those with relevant industry experience who are interested in passing on their skills to others.

If you are a horticulture enthusiast with the ability to inspire, motivate and challenge students and if you are able to impart knowledge and develop understanding that promotes a love of learning and develops intellectual curiosity, we want to hear from you. This is a part‑time role, working 21.6 hours per week. The actual salary £16,621.20 – £25,612.20 inclusive of London Weighting.

Over the last 50 years, Capel Manor College has helped thousands of school leavers and adults achieve their dream of working with animals, plants and the environment. As London’s environmental college, the College plays a vital role in the green agenda for the capital, equipping the next generation of land‑based sector workers with the skills and knowledge needed to preserve and protect London’s wildlife, national parks and green spaces.
